SUV Slams into Cars, House in Hillcrest

A driver in Hillcrest lost control of his Toyota early on Monday, ping-ponging from a parked car into a house before becoming trapped inside the vehicle.

Emergency operators got a call at about 6:15 a.m. about the wreck near the intersection of Tyler and Cleveland avenues.

"The driver was making a movement to the left -- and it's really unsure what he was planning on doing -- either making a U-turn or just making a left turn," said San Diego police Officer Patrick Laco. "For whatever reason, the vehicle went right through a parked vehicle and continued onto private property and collided with the building."

Laco said the driver was trapped in his car after the crash and was rescued by firefighters. It's not clear what injuries the driver suffered. Laco said he did not believe drugs or alcohol played in part in the crash.

The driver was taken to a nearby hospital after the wreck, police said. Nobody else was injured in the crash.
